Over the past 50 years, China has undergone profound transformations, shifting from a largely agrarian society to a global economic powerhouse. The implementation of market reforms in the late 1970s spurred rapid industrialization and urbanization, lifting hundreds of millions out of poverty. China's global influence has grown, marked by its significant investments in infrastructure and technology worldwide, while it also faces challenges such as environmental issues and social inequality. Additionally, the political landscape has remained tightly controlled, with the Communist Party maintaining strict governance amid rising demands for greater personal freedoms.
